Practical Information for Visitors
To reach Snækollur, it is advisable to rent a car, as public transport does not go directly to the mountain. It is important to plan your visit according to weather conditions, as the weather in Iceland can change rapidly. Make sure to wear appropriate clothing and hiking shoes to tackle the variable terrain.
Finally, don't forget to bring food and water with you, as there are no facilities along the trails.
